Abstract | 为减轻大量禽畜废弃物中氨气流失对环境的污染,研究和优化了微生物与秸秆等辅料对氨气释放量的影响。结果表明,F468、M1?M9等除臭微生物能显著降低氨气的释放量,其中F468是最优微生物,其它微生物与F468的配伍并没有显著增强F468降低氨气释放量的能力,有些微生物还降低了其能力,因此选择单一微生物法降低氨气释放量。单独添加辅料对降低氨气的释放影响较小,辅料与微生物的配伍可大量降低氨气的释放量。5%的F468与10%的秸秆配伍在1?5 d降低88%的释放量。应用微生物与秸秆不仅降低氨气挥发对环境的危害,也是秸秆资源化利用的有效途径之一。 |
